| Summary: | Chapter 2 of the book "Sofía Casanova (1861-1958): Spanish Woman Poet, Journalist and Author" is presented. The chapter recounts the early years of Casanova's married and family life with Lutoslawski as they travelled through Europe. It mentions Lutoslawski's belief that his life's mission concerned the re-emergence of Poland as a nation. The entry also notes Casanova's concern over Spain's lax atmosphere and rotating Liberal-Conservative government have brought the country in a state of ignorance and apathy. |
